The Journey to Sustainable Weight Loss: A Balanced Approach

  Weight loss is a topic that garners significant attention in today's society, with countless fad diets and quick-fix solutions flooding the market. However, achieving and maintaining a healthy weight is a long-term commitment that requires a balanced approach. In this article, we delve into the key principles of sustainable weight loss, focusing on adopting healthy habits, making informed dietary choices, embracing physical activity, and nurturing a positive mindset. Set Realistic Goals: Before embarking on a weight loss journey, it is crucial to set realistic and achievable goals. Rather than fixating on an ideal number on the scale, prioritize overall well-being, improved energy levels, and enhanced self-confidence. Aim for gradual, steady progress, as crash diets or extreme measures often lead to unsustainable outcomes and potential health risks. The Importance of Self-Care for Mental Health

 Self-care is a crucial aspect of maintaining good mental health, yet it is often overlooked or neglected in our busy lives. Self-care refers to any activity or practice that we engage in to promote our physical, emotional, and mental well-being. In this article, we will explore the importance of self-care for mental health and provide tips on how to practice it regularly. First and foremost, self-care is essential for reducing stress and anxiety. When we are stressed or anxious, our bodies release cortisol, a hormone that can have negative effects on our physical and mental health over time. Engaging in self-care practices, such as exercise, meditation, or spending time in nature, can help to reduce cortisol levels and promote relaxation. Self-care is also important for improving our mood and overall mental health. Title: Jimmy Carter- A Life Dedicated To Service

Title : Jimmy Carter- A  Life Dedicated To Service Jimmy Carter is a name that has become synonymous with public service. Born in Plains, Georgia, in 1924, he went on to become the 39th President of the United States, serving from 1977 to 1981. His presidency was marked by many important accomplishments, including the Camp David Accords, the Panama Canal Treaty, and the creation of the Department of Education. However, his dedication to public service did not end with his time in office. After leaving the White House, Jimmy Carter founded the Carter Center in 1982, a nonprofit organization dedicated to promoting human rights and preventing and resolving conflicts. The center has done important work around the world, including monitoring elections, promoting democracy, and fighting neglected diseases such as river blindness and trachoma.
